By Visen I bought this speaker because I wanted to play music from my iPhone wirelessly while retaining high quality sound. In that respect, I am not disappointed as the sound is very rich with plenty of bass and clear mids/highs. I was concerned that the bluetooth transmission would introduce artifacts/digital distortion, but I can't hear any.
My only complaint is the iPhone pairing which can be a bit finicky, especially when you switch between different iPhones. It will either take a few seconds for the music to start or you will need to press the connect/reset buttons.

Great with iPod, bad with computerJan 03, 2011
By wch I'll put this out there first: the sound quality is excellent using the wireless transmitters. It's close to the ideal setup for an iPod/iPhone, but due to human interface issues, it's just not good for use with a computer, at least not with the BT-D1 wireless transmitter that Creative makes.
With an iPod, it's great: you can play music wirelessly, control the volume, and you can charge your iPod by sticking it in the special dock. It's very liberating. The cons are: - Controlling the volume control from the iPod works most of the time, but often has lag, and about 25% of the time doesn't do anything to the speaker volume. - Volume control increments are too large, especially at the quieter end.
It would also be nice to have the option of having a separate charging dock for the iPod, but which allows you to continue using the special transmitter. Then you could have the dock in a close-at-hand place, and the speakers out of the way somewhere, like on a high shelf.
I dislike the touch interface for controlling volume on the speakers. There's no tactile feedback, and it doesn't detect the finger motion all that well, so adjusting it is more finicky than a dial.
Now, as for use with a computer.... With the BT-D1 wireless transmitter, it's not possible to control the volume of these speakers from the computer, or to control the system volume. That means that you have to control the volume from each application or adjust it on the speakers themselves, but that sort of defeats the purpose of having wireless speakers that can be placed anywhere. The volume of some things can't be controlled at the application level, like system alerts (on a Mac, at least), or some Flash web pages that don't have volume control. Why did Creative do this? It doesn't make any sense -- the BT-D1 allows volume control with other speakers in Creative's lineup, and the D5 speakers can be controlled with the iPod transmitter (BT-D5). For more information, you can see my review of the BT-D1. Creative BT-D1 USB transmitter
In short, when using these speakers with a computer (and the BT-D1 transmitter), it's very inconvenient, and this defeats the major purpose of getting wireless speakers in the first place.
